Sign in Agent Mode
Categories
Become a Channel Partner Sell in AWS Marketplace Amazon Web Services Home Help

Barracuda Cloud-to-Cloud Backup

Barracuda Networks

Reviews from AWS customer

2 AWS reviews

External reviews

167 reviews
from and

External reviews are not included in the AWS star rating for the product.


    Information Technology and Services

Reliable Cloud-to-Cloud Backups Without On-Prem Hassle

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
The upsides of using barracuda cloud to cloud back up is not having to keep the backups on prem and are with a reliable company.
What do you dislike about the product?
Nothing that I have disliked so far with what we've seen.
What problems is the product solving and how is that benefiting you?
It's solving multiple problems, including not having to host the backups with our own storage along with having a resource available to do this automatically.


    Tim G.

Simple, Worry-Free Exchange & OneDrive Restores

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
One word - simple. Select the service - in my case we mostly use it for Exchange and OneDrive. I never have to worry about a user that unexpectedly leaves and deletes all their data. Just step back one or two days and do a full restore.
What do you dislike about the product?
Downloads - ie: restoring a mailbox or selected items to PST can be a little slow.
What problems is the product solving and how is that benefiting you?
Takes the burden of all the management minutia. No servers to worry about.


    Buddy N.

Effortless Backup with Reliable Restore Points

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
I like the ease of use of Barracuda Cloud-to-Cloud Backup and that it's very easy to set up and implement. The ability to restore anything with multiple restore points is critical for us. A couple of years ago, an incident affected many people's OneDrive, and Barracuda Cloud-to-Cloud Backup allowed us to seamlessly restore affected data quickly and accurately. We use it to back up our O365 environment, and it solves the problem of worrying and managing those backups effectively.
What do you dislike about the product?
Nothing, really. It just works.
What problems is the product solving and how is that benefiting you?
I use Barracuda Cloud-to-Cloud Backup to manage and secure our O365 backups, eliminating worries about data loss. It's very easy to set up, and I appreciate its multiple restore points feature for quick and accurate data recovery.


    Mark G.

Effortless Backup with Rapid Recovery

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
I like that Barracuda Cloud-to-Cloud Backup was easy to set up and implement. It's simple to function and provides the reporting we need to ensure things are actually working. The features reduce the amount of effort our staff has to put into maintaining it, allowing them to do other work. This ease contributes to a faster return on investment.
What do you dislike about the product?
It would be nice if the Cloud to Cloud backup was just a feature of Barracuda's backup solution, instead of being a separate application.
What problems is the product solving and how is that benefiting you?
I use Barracuda Cloud-to-Cloud Backup to ensure compliance for Microsoft 365, allowing quick and easy data restoration with minimal effort. It reduces staff maintenance effort, speeding up ROI and enabling focus on other tasks.


    Brandon F.

Effortless Backup with Some UI Flaws

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
I really like how easy it is to access offsite cloud backups with Barracuda Cloud-to-Cloud Backup. It's a 'set it and forget it' type of setup, which means I don't have to worry about it. The software is easy to use and runs without issues, and I appreciate that I don't need to adjust anything with the backups when we add new SharePoint sites or mailboxes. The initial setup was also very simple.
What do you dislike about the product?
I find the user interface could be improved. There's a lot of wasted white space on the pages. Additionally, when I'm searching for a specific item to restore, the folders you need to drill through could be made more clear.
What problems is the product solving and how is that benefiting you?
Barracuda Cloud-to-Cloud Backup provides easy offsite cloud backups for our Microsoft 365 environment. It’s a 'set it and forget it' solution, so I don't have to worry. It’s easy to use, runs without issues, and requires no adjustments when new SharePoint sites or mailboxes are added.


    anoop p.

easy setup & good support

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
ease of setup & single pane of management access
What do you dislike about the product?
support is good & they are very helpful, would like to get more detailed documentation to read through.
What problems is the product solving and how is that benefiting you?
whenever we had issues with our file system or OS, barracuda backup helps us resolve it instantly.


    Anne R.

Easy Setup and Smooth Backup & Restore Experience

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
Ease of Setup, Backup & Restore. Dashboard is very simple and easy to ue.
What do you dislike about the product?
Better faster restore times in from backups.
What problems is the product solving and how is that benefiting you?
Backing up O365 & Entra ID environments for us.


    David H.

Simple Setup and Reliable Microsoft 365 Exchange Backups

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
This was fairly simple to setup. We backup mainly Microsoft 365 Exchange data nightly. We have had to restore data as well. It has been running for about 2 years with no issues.
What do you dislike about the product?
Would like a little more detailed reporting regarding total size stored, etc.
What problems is the product solving and how is that benefiting you?
We need to backup critical users Email data


    Thomas W.

Reliable Backup with Easy Setup, Needs Improved File Retrieval

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
I think the easy setup for restoring an entire mailbox, OneDrive, Teams project, or SharePoint folder is quite convenient. The date range finder is also very helpful. With some quick hands-on experience, you can easily understand the restore mechanics, and even if restoring can be time-consuming depending on what you're restoring, at least you know that you will never lose your data. Even if your data is compromised, you can restore it through backups.
What do you dislike about the product?
If you are trying to find a file that was deleted, the process is laborious and requires patience. You may need to plow through multiple dates in order to find the file and the correct version.
What problems is the product solving and how is that benefiting you?
Barracuda Cloud-to-Cloud Backup helps me restore missing files and backs up OneDrive/Email for terminated users. The easy setup and helpful date range finder streamline restoring, and I have peace of mind that data can be recovered even if compromised.


    Scott B.

Easy Setup and Straightforward Management with Barracuda Cloud-to-Cloud Backups

  • January 23, 2026
  • Review provided by G2

What do you like best about the product?
Barracuda Cloud-to-Cloud Backups are easy to set up and manage, and the overall experience feels straightforward.
What do you dislike about the product?
The interface could be improved somewhat.
What problems is the product solving and how is that benefiting you?
Barracuda Cloud-to-Cloud Backup has removed the worry of managing an on-prem backup system, making the whole backup process feel much simpler and easier to maintain.